While he’s got the most approval from his constituents, than any other Canadian Premier, Scott Moe, with an approval rating of 57 per cent, is still three points down from last quarter.
The Angus Reid Poll shows Nova Scotia Premier Tim Houston coming in second at 55 per cent.
Manitoba Premier Heather Stefanson came in last, with an approval rating of just 25 per cent just months before voters go to the polls. And Alberta’s Premier, the newly re-elected Danielle Smith, sits sixth with a 45 per cent approval rating.
